#range #middleware #ipv4 #ipv6 #ip #actix-middleware #ip-address

actix-allow-deny-middleware

Middlewares for denying or allowing IPv4 and IPv6 ranges

1 unstable release

new 0.1.0 Feb 28, 2025

#671 in HTTP server

MIT license

21KB
390 lines

actix-allow-deny-middleware

Actix middlewares

This crate provides two middlewares for Actix web applications:

  • AllowMiddleware: allows requests from specific IP addresses or ranges.
  • DisallowMiddleware: disallows requests from specific IP addresses or ranges.

License: MIT


lib.rs:

Actix middlewares

This crate provides two middlewares for Actix web applications:

  • AllowMiddleware: allows requests from specific IP addresses or ranges.
  • DisallowMiddleware: disallows requests from specific IP addresses or ranges.

Dependencies

~15–26MB
~447K SLoC